精打细算 用更少水种出更多粮
Liao Ning Ri Bao· 2025-08-09 01:28
Core Insights - The province is conducting a comprehensive measurement of the effective utilization coefficient of irrigation water in farmland for the year 2025, selecting 83 representative irrigation districts for testing [1] - The effective utilization coefficient is a key indicator for assessing the efficiency of water resource management and is crucial for implementing national water-saving actions [1] Group 1: Irrigation Water Utilization - The effective utilization coefficient varies by season and crop growth period, being lower during high-temperature droughts in summer and higher in spring and autumn [1] - Different crops exhibit varying coefficients, with rice and corn generally having higher utilization rates compared to wheat and soybeans [1] Group 2: Infrastructure Development - Since the 14th Five-Year Plan, the province has implemented 33 new and modernized irrigation projects with a total investment of 4.486 billion yuan, enhancing irrigation and drainage infrastructure [2] - The projects have added or restored 356,000 acres of irrigated land and improved 3.68 million acres, resulting in a new water-saving capacity of 300 million cubic meters [2] Group 3: Current Status and Future Directions - The effective utilization coefficient of irrigation water in the province reached 0.593 in 2024, above the national average and showing a stable increase of 0.011 since 2014, indicating significant water-saving effects [2] - There is a noted reliance on surface irrigation methods, with challenges in promoting water-saving technologies like sprinkler and drip irrigation due to high costs and technical difficulties [2]
